Swedish children’s wear brand Mini Rodini and American denim giant Wrangler® have announced the launch of a limited-edition capsule collection for kids. The capsule collection is a harmonious blend of Wrangler’s classic styles and Mini Rodini’s signature Peace Dove print, all made from 100% GOTS-certified cotton. The collection offers a range of denim and jersey style garments, including jackets, vests, jeans, sweater sets, tees, dresses, baby onesies, and underwear. Each piece prominently features Wrangler’s iconic ‘W’ stitching, adding a touch of authenticity to the collection.
Mini Rodini, founded by Cassandra Rhodin in 2006, has been lauded for its unique interpretation of children’s clothes. The brand’s commitment to creating clothes that children love to wear without compromising on environmental and social aspects of production has earned it international acclaim. This ethos is clearly reflected in the new capsule collection, which combines Mini Rodini’s playful designs with Wrangler’s expertise in denim. Wrangler,…
an enduring symbol of American freedom, is known for its durable jeans and workwear. The brand’s mission to design clothing that fits the needs of the people wearing it aligns perfectly with Mini Rodini’s vision, making this collaboration a natural fit.
“We wanted to combine our expertise in denim with Mini Rodini’s playful designs for children’s clothing,” said Vivian Rivetti, vice president of global design at Wrangler. “It has been such an incredible experience to reimagine classic Wrangler silhouettes for our youngest fans.
Each style is designed to withstand the test of time and the many adventures of kids, with pieces that can be passed down from sibling to sibling. And while we are really excited about the design, it was very important to maintain both brands’ commitment to sustainability for a better, healthier and happier planet.
